Transaction 7068377b3393a890c5abca3ae834783e3869704ceb1203db75d8f6106321d6f4

20 Input
2 Outputs
  • 7068377b3393a890c5abca3ae834783e3869704ceb1203db75d8f6106321d6f4:0
  • value  489348908
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 7068377b3393a890c5abca3ae834783e3869704ceb1203db75d8f6106321d6f4:1
  • value  696201
    address  12Hu3rPaxB76e2gFb2C2VRhYELLVaJGush